View cart “Meanings of the Noble Quran with Explanatory Notes | Complete Quran in 1 Volume, 2 Colour (HB)” has been added to your cart.
View cart “Kitabul Umrah – English – Pocket” has been added to your cart.
View cart “Kitabul Umrah – English – Pocket” has been added to your cart.